Description

We are delighted to offer to the market this 3-bedroom terraced house on Powell Avenue, Blackpool.

Upon entering this inviting property, you are welcomed by a UPVC double glazed door opening into the hallway. The staircase gracefully ascends to the first floor landing, adorned with fitted carpet underfoot and illuminated by a ceiling light. A convenient meter cupboard stands nearby.

The lounge, bathed in natural light from its double glazed bay window overlooking the front, exudes a sense of spaciousness. Decorative coved ceilings enhance the room, complemented by a warming wall-mounted electric living flame fire. This central living space is equipped with a television point and features plush carpeting, while practicality is addressed with access to under stair storage and a doorway leading into the kitchen.

The kitchen is tastefully appointed with matching wall and base units, harmonized by complementary work surfaces. Essential appliances include an integrated stainless steel single oven and a four-ring gas hob with an overhead extractor. A stainless steel sink with a mixer tap sits beneath a double glazed window overlooking the rear garden. There is ample space for freestanding undercounter fridge, freezer, and a washing machine. A door seamlessly connects this culinary space to the conservatory, an invaluable addition offering further living area. French doors extend the living space outdoors onto the rear garden, while spotlights illuminate the room and double glazed windows flank its sides.

The downstairs bathroom features a practical three-piece suite comprising a panelled bath with an overhead shower, a pedestal wash hand basin, and a low flush WC. Partially tiled walls add a touch of elegance, alongside a storage cupboard for convenience. A double glazed window provides natural light from the rear elevation.

Ascending to the first floor via the landing, you'll find doors leading to all rooms. The landing also offers access to the loft space for additional storage.

Bedroom One boasts a double glazed window to the front elevation, casting natural light across the room adorned with a ceiling light.

Bedroom Two overlooks the rear garden through a double glazed window, featuring fitted carpet, a ceiling light, and a radiator.

Bedroom Three benefits from a double glazed window to the rear, bathing the room in natural light enhanced by a ceiling light and complemented by fitted carpet.

Outside, the rear garden presents a generous expanse of lawn, ideal for outdoor activities, accompanied by a raised decked area perfect for seating. A timber-built shed provides practical storage solutions within the fenced enclosure. The front garden is enclosed by a wall with gated access, adding privacy and security to this welcoming home.
